This paper presents the model test to measure the second-order wave pressureand forces on a circular cylinder fixed in Stokes wave with a given draught.The distributions ofsecond-order oscillating and steady wave pressure on the wet surface of the cylinder and secondorder oscillating wave forces were obtained in this test,but the second-order steady wave forcewas not able to be measured due to its very small magnitude.The test results also show thatthird-order wave force may be greater than the second-order force when wave frequencies arehigh.The experimental results were compared with the corresponding calculation results of Ref-erence[3].
